Anti-HIV Activity in Vitro of MGN-3, an Activated Arainoxylane from Rice Bran
Mamdooh Ghoneum1998 MGN-3, an arabinoxylane from rice bran that has been enzymatically modified with extract from Hyphomycetes mycelia, was tested for anti-HIV activity in vitro. MGN-3 activity against HIV-1 (SF strain) was examined in primary cultures of peripheral blood mononuclear cells. Enhancement of human natural killer cell activity by modified arabinoxylan from rice bran (MGN-3)
Mamdooh Ghoneum1998 Arabinoxylane from rice bran (MGN-3) was examined for its augmentory effect on human NK (NK) cell activity in vivo and in vitro. Twenty-four individuals were given MGN-3 orally at three different concentrations: 15, 30 and 45 mg/kg/day for 2 months.
